    Our last 19 games in all competitions we've won 16 and lost 3. I don't think it's that hard to find positives in how things are going.
    Before that run we were 6th, 12 points away from City in 2nd place. Now we're in 3rd just a point away from them.
    We're out of the CL but we've got to the FA Cup semi-final, beating Utd in their own back yard along the way.

    Anyway, today was another important win.
